[Bug]: ReActAgentWorker._arun_step_stream drops tokens that arrive before is_done=True #14307

Open Tshimanga opened 2 months ago

Tshimanga commented 2 months ago

Bug Description

In ReActAgentWorker._arun_step_stream, any tokens generated before the is_done condition triggers are dropped.

Version

0.10.38 thru 0.10.46

Steps to Reproduce

from llama_index.core.agent import ReActAgent
from llama_index.llms.openai import OpenAI

llm = OpenAI(
    temperature=0,
    api_key="...",
    model="gpt-4-turbo",
    streaming=True,
)
agent = ReActAgent.from_tools(llm=llm, tools=[])

chat_stream = await agent.astream_chat("Write a couple sentences about the beach.")
async for token in chat_stream.async_response_gen():
    print(token)

logan-markewich commented 2 months ago

@Tshimanga don't we want to drop those tokens? The idea is the stream shouldn't include all the agents thoughts, just the final response

Tshimanga commented 2 months ago

@logan-markewich What you say makes sense, but it looks like I came to premature conclusions when debugging.

The issue I've been encountering is that too much of the response gets dropped. I'm ending up with sentences like (as a response to the reproducer above):

" beach is a magical place where golden sands stretch underfoot and the ocean whispers in a constant, soothing murmur. It's an ideal spot for families and friends to gather, share moments, and indulge in the simple joys of nature, from watching the sunset to collecting seashells along the shore."

Where the "The" got dropped.

When I was initially stepping through the debugger and testing fixes I didn't see any preceding text for the thought process in latest_token.message.content. That is, latest_token.message.content was "The beach" and not "Thought: ... Answer: The beach" in my local testing, but I've since seen the second case as well.

Tshimanga commented 2 months ago

@logan-markewich ah ok, I think I found the actual issue. In ReActAgentWorker._infer_stream_chunk_is_final there is the following condition:

.
.
.
            if len(latest_content) > len("Thought") and not latest_content.startswith(
                "Thought"
            ):
                return True
.
.
.

If the the LLM doesn't follow thought-action format, but the beginning of the response is a short token like "The" then ReActAgentWorker._infer_stream_chunk_is_final fails to recognize this first token and ends up skipping it.

Does this seems like more so the actual issue here?

logan-markewich commented 1 month ago

@Tshimanga I think so, and I think https://github.com/run-llama/llama_index/pull/14587 is an attempt at solving this
